The rolling resistance and the effective radius of a tyre are two important characteristics that are very useful for vehicle diagnosis and wheel monitoring systems. This paper proposes to consider the physical model of rotational and longitudinal dynamics of the wheel and to apply a variable structure observer for an on-line estimation of these quantities using measurement of wheel angular velocity,...
This paper proposes an application of a variable structure observer for wheel effective radius and velocity of automotive vehicles. This observer is based on high order sliding approach allowing robustness and finite time convergence. Its originality consists in assuming a nonlinear relation between the slip ratio and the friction coefficient and providing an estimation of both variables, wheel radius...
